Hydrogen sulfide (or hydrogen sulphide) is the chemical compound with the formula H2S. This colorless, toxic and flammable gas is responsible for the foul odour of rotten eggs and flatulence. It often results from the bacterial break down of organic matter in the absence of oxygen, such as in swamps and sewers (anaerobic digestion). It also occurs in volcanic gases, natural gas and some well waters. The odour of H2S is commonly misattributed to elemental sulfur, which is in fact odorless.

Odour Monitoring Ireland provides:

  • Ambient and abatement technology monitoring of H2S using both wet chemistry and analyser techniques;
  • Continuous data logging capabilities for long-term cyclic mapping of H2S using a continuous ambient air analyser (long term sampling);
  • Generation of H2S map of process and/or site operations.
  • High temperature continuous process H2S sampling and analysis using our flue gas stack sampling technique.
